Evolution of IT industry can be phased into 4 stages.

PHASE I: Prior to 1980

Indian IT industry was basically started with hardware and software industry was very much
non-existent until 1960. Government protected the hardware sector with high tariff and
licensing. In 1972 the government came up with software export scheme in which software
and hardware were allowed to export, TCS ltd was the first company to agree to this. The
beginning of software exports was made in 1974.

PHASE II: 1980-1990

During this phase the software could not reach the level expected because of two reasons.
The export of software was too much dependent on the hardware and procedure was too
cumbersome. The presence of rigid infrastructural structure for software was necessary,
procedural complications and import was mandatorily reduced. With the newly formulated
policy on software creators and exporters the government liberalized the IT industry.
PHASE III: 1990-2000

This decade noticed huge competition and companies investing in rigorous R&D and
bringing the best software services. This competition started showing difference in the
nation’s economy, liberalization of trade, foreign investments taking place and majorly
devaluation of rupee. This leads to the introduction of MNCs, offshore model, on site model,
and many other distinguished services.

PHASE IV: Post 2000

The worldwide issues like Y2k, the dotcom crash and the downturn in the US economy has
constrained numerous US firms to use the administrations of the Indian firms. This has come
about in setting the Indian IT industry on the worldwide guide. Post 2002 – 03, the business
had enlisted a powerful development rate. During this period there was an expansion in the

Indian customer base, huge measured agreements and a solid worldwide conveyance model.

PROJECT 1: REQUEST FOR PROPOSAL (RFP)

A Request for Proposal, or RFP, is a document created by a corporation, non-profit or


government entity to describe the criteria for a specific project. Using the RFP process, they
solicit bids from interested vendors and determine which vendor could be the best suited to
complete the project.

Why organisations create RFP?

Detailing the organisation’s need in an RFP will gauge the vendor’s understanding about the
project in a better way. Using RFPs also ensures the organisations to create benchmarks they
can sue later to measure a project’ success. RFPs also promote accountability for government
agencies and non-profits, and inform the public that they are accountable for project priorities
and vendor choices.

How does RFP process work?

Determine what matters most: Set the scoring criteria you will use to select a vendor by
deciding what matters most: a vendor’s cost estimate, skill set, or references and reviews.
Doing this before publicly releasing your RFP reduces the number of proposals you must
seriously consider and makes it easier to rank them.

Create the RFP: Identify the needs for the project, including the specific information listed
in the section below. To help vendors understand your proposal, edit it to make sure you have
explained your requirements clearly and concisely, so the bids you receive will more likely
align with your organization’s mission.

What Should You Include in an RFP?


Although each RFP will vary according to the needs and goals of a project, most include the
same categories of information:

 The history of an organization


 A detailed description of the project, including the reason it was created and the
results you desire
 Specific requirements about preferred materials, tools, systems, and/or products
 The budget
 The project deadline, along with clearly defined milestones and dates
 Questions you would like the respondents to answer or additional details you would
like them to provide
 The submission deadline, contact information, and guidelines to submit proposals

What Do You Do When You Finish Your RFP?


Share the RFP: Give vendors plenty of time to find and respond to your RFP by providing it
to them online, via trade news outlets, and in field-specific settings.

Negotiate with the vendor you select: Once you award the project to a vendor, review the cost
of each line item with that vendor and negotiate further to lower the bid.

Preparing the Proposals (RFP)

A Request for Proposal (RFP) is a business document announcing and providing details of a
project, as well as soliciting bids from contractors that will help complete the project. Many
companies tend to use RFPs, and in many instances governments do use proposal requests. A
proposal for a particular program may require that the organization review the bids to analyse
their viability, the health of the bidder and the capacity of the bidder to do what is proposed.

RFPs detail the procurement procedure and contract terms, and offer instructions on how bids
should be structured and delivered. They are generally reserved for complex projects. These
requests define the purpose of the project and the appraisal requirements that indicate how
projects are assessed. Requests that include a contract statement, a summary of the tasks to be
performed by the winning bidder and a timetable for finished work. These also provide
information about the issuing company and its business line.
RFPs also guide bidders on how to prepare proposals. They may outline instructions on what
information the bidder must include and the desired format.

KEY TAKEAWAYS:

 A request for proposal is a project funding announcement posted by an organization


for which companies place bids.
 The RFP outlines the bidding process and contract terms and guides how the bid
should be formatted.
 RFPs are used primarily by government agencies to get the lowest possible bid.
 RFPs allow the requesting company to get multiple bidders.

Social media marketing is the use of social media channels to communicate with your
audience to create your brand, improve sales and increase traffic on websites. This includes
posting positive content on your social media pages, listening to your followers and engaging
them, reviewing your stats, and running social media ads.

Why Social Media Marketing?

1. Your customers are on social media: One of the major reasons to use social media
marketing is that your customers are spending time on these media platforms. The
stats say that at least 70% of U.S. population have any one of the media presence
(profile) by 2021 the usage of social media is expected be reaching 3.1 billion people.
2. Consumers are more receptive through the media: Users are active on social media
sites as these networks provide a fun and convenient way to network, keep in contact
with friends and family, and stay updated to what's happening around the world.
Users are not necessarily on such platforms with the hope they would be sold to. But
that does not mean that consumers of social media are not following their favourite
brands and engaging with them.
3. Marketing in social media enhances customers association: Benefit of marketing
through social media is that it helps to increase the exposure and thereby improves
brand’s awareness. Company’s social media accounts give new ways to share their
content and to really show the voice and personality of the brand. By sharing
engaging content that brings value to the target market, making the brand more
available to new members and existing customers as well as more familiar. Ex:
PlayStation keeps their users always connected, especially.
4. Diversity in social media helps reach specific audience: Another strategy in social
media is that company can target specific audience through different channels of this
platform rather than just putting your marketing out for everyone whether the user is
or isn’t interested. Creating a clear list of demographic values for audience, the more
detailed the better. This list may include their gender, age, location, interests,
following brands, hobbies etc. This information shall give a upper hand in creating
content apt to the targeted consumer.
5. Marketing in social media is cost effective: One of the biggest benefits of social media
marketing is that it lets the company cut back on marketing expenses without losing
results. Most of the success on social media will come from spending time in
producing and publishing content, as well as communicating with customers and
followers. The good news is that only a few hours a week will deliver positive results.
In reality, HubSpot estimates that with as little as six hours of effort spent on social
media each week, 84 each cent of marketers were able to generate increased traffic.
